The Coroners Court of Queensland (CCQ) supports the State Coroner’s statutory function to oversee & coordinate the Queensland coronial system by providing registry, administrative & legal support to ten full time Coroners and two registrars. Under the Coroners Act 2003, Coroners are responsible for investigating reportable deaths that occur in Queensland. This investigation seeks to determine the identity of the deceased person, when and where they died, how they died and the medical cause of death. Where an inquest is held, the Coroner may make recommendations about public health and safety, or the administration of justice or ways to prevent similar deaths from occurring in the future.

The Legal Officer works as part of a team of counsel assisting coroners in coronial investigations and inquests. The role reports to a Senior Counsel Assisting (PO6) in the Legal Services Team.

Your Key Responsibilities

Work collaboratively with Coroners, the Domestic and Family Violence Death Review Unit, the Queensland Police Service and other stakeholders.

Maintain a limited case load of coronial files and provide advice including in respect of avenues of investigation and whether an inquest is warranted.

From time to time, appear at inquest either as counsel assisting or instructing counsel assisting the coroner as directed.

Summarise evidence at inquest and prepare submissions regarding coronial findings and recommendations.

Provide legal advice and legal guidance and analysis as required.

Cultivate productive working relationships with judicial officers and CCQ staff and model professional behaviour and standards at all times.
